Master Different Cooking Methods + Sous Vide

Cooking is an art that requires skill, practice, and a good understanding of various cooking methods. Whether you are a seasoned chef or a home cook looking to up your culinary game, mastering different cooking techniques can help you elevate your dishes to the next level. One such method that has gained popularity in recent years is sous vide cooking.

1. Grilling

Grilling is a popular cooking method that imparts a unique flavor to food through the caramelization that occurs when food comes into contact with an open flame. Whether you are grilling vegetables, meats, or seafood, mastering the art of grilling can take your outdoor cooking skills to new heights.

2. Roasting

Roasting involves cooking food in an oven at high temperatures. This method is great for meats, poultry, and vegetables, as it helps to caramelize the exterior while keeping the interior moist and flavorful. Mastering roasting techniques can help you achieve perfectly cooked dishes every time.

3. Sauteing

Sautéing is a quick cooking method that involves cooking food in a small amount of oil over high heat. This technique is perfect for cooking vegetables, meats, and seafood quickly while preserving their natural flavors and textures. Mastering sautéing can help you whip up delicious meals in no time.

4. Sous Vide Cooking

Sous vide cooking is a technique that involves cooking food in a precisely controlled water bath at a consistent low temperature. This method ensures that food is cooked evenly from edge to edge, resulting in perfectly cooked dishes with enhanced flavors and textures. Mastering sous vide cooking can help you achieve restaurant-quality results in the comfort of your own kitchen.
